Economy & Jobs

Holly Lake Ranch residents earn a median household income of $77,245 , which is 3%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$58,628. The unemployment rate stands at 2.0% (44%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 6.6%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 943 business establishments, including 86 restaurants.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Holly Lake Ranch is $239,400 , 15%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$249,931. Median rent is $1,313/month, with 13.6%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 97.1 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1992.

Safety & Crime

Holly Lake Ranch reports 300 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 21%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 2,399/100K.

Education

48.4% of adults in Holly Lake Ranch hold a bachelor's degree or higher (44% above the national average). 98.8% have completed high school. Local schools score 5.3/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Holly Lake Ranch has an average annual temperature of 63°F (17°C). Winters average 44°F in January while summers reach 82°F in July. The area gets 308 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 47.9 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 42.
